On good sites in dense forest stands American elm may reach 30 to 38 m (98 to 125 ft) in height and 122 to 152 cm (48 to 60 in) in d.b.h., with a 15 m (49 ft) clear bole. Dutch elm disease, a fatal fungal disease spread by airborne bark beetles, attacks the water-conducting tissue of the tree, resulting in wilting, defoliation and death. The camperdown elm at Prospect Park was a gift from Mr. A. Burgess in 1872 and was one of the first camperdown elms propagated in the United States. The Princeton's track record is now long and strong, but two newer cultivars are considered very hardy against the Dutch elm disease the Valley Forge (Ulmus americana 'Valley Forge') and the New Harmony (Ulmus americana 'New Harmony'), which have a 96 percent and 86 percent rate of resistance against Dutch elm disease, according to the USDA. .
